Please Help I drove my 1994 Jeep Wrangler home from work this morning, only let warmup for about 1min (literally) and drove 45-50 MPH for about 5 miles before getting on interstate. Drove another 10-12 before getting home. Heard a metal on metal sound, pulled into neighborhood and was stopped, Coolant came rushing out of the bottom of the car onto the street, there appears to be some oil sprey on underside of the hood, a little whites smoke -think is the coolant on the engine. I turned the car off and checked the oil level and it appears ok, I can't identify a leak for either. Anyone have any advise? How to go about determining the problem?

Just a wild thought: Did fan go loose and attack radiator? The low coolant for any reason would at speed especially cause a quick overheat and head gasket issues would be unknown until you do HT's test and more. Oil? If still drips available and coolant not oil it would rinse off with water - oil wouldn't, T
